Lower East Side, Manhattan, NY, 12/28/09

Address: 154 Broome St between Attorney and Ridge Sts

Phone Box 265 - Report of smoke on the 11th floor
Engs. 15, 55, 28
TL18, L20
Battalion 4


10-75-265 - 19:43 hours
Battalion 4: Box 265, transmit a 10-75, we have fire in apartment 11D.
E33
L6 (FAST Truck)
Battalion 2
Rescue 1
Squad 18
Division 1


10-77-265 - 19:45 hours
BC4: Box 265, 10-77 the box, we have fire out into the hallway, k.
E5 (CFRD Engine)
E7 (High-Rise Nozzle Co.)
E3 w/ High-Rise 1
TL9, TL1
Battalions 1, Rescue, Safety
Battalion 6 (Safety Officer)
FieldCom


19:45 hours
Division 1: Have the Squad and Rescue report in with their blankets.

19:46 hours
BC4: By orders of the 4th Battalion, cancel the 10-77, the fire is actually in the hallway and they are knocking it down now.
(All 10-77 companies returned to service)

18:49 hours
Receiving report of smoke on the 21st floor

18:53 hours
List of apartments received: 11D, 13F, 15B, 15G, 20A, 20H, 21C

18:53 hours - Duration 17 minutes
DC1: At this time the primaries on the fire floor are negative and we'll go with a Probably Will Hold.

7-5-265 - 19:56 hours
DC1: Size up is as follows: we have 26 story 50x75 flat roof with a light fire condition.  Using All-Hands, we are Probably Will Hold.  No exposure problems.
RAC1

Exposures are:
1 - courtyard
2 - street
3 - empty lot
4 - street

19:57 hours
Rescue 1, Squad 18 are 10-8

20:00 hours
TL15 is 10-8 in TL18's response area

20:03 hours
DC1 requests a mixer-off message.

20:08 hours - Duration 30 minutes
DC1: At this time, Division 1 places this Under Control.  All secondaries in the building are negative, all apartments are negative, and the A and B stair are negative.
